// Licensed to the .NET Foundation under one or more agreements. // The .NET Foundation licenses this file to you under the MIT license. // See the LICENSE file in the project root for more information. using System.Collections.Immutable; using System.Diagnostics; using Microsoft.CodeAnalysis.PooledObjects; namespace Microsoft.CodeAnalysis.CSharp { internal abstract partial class BoundTreeWalker : BoundTreeVisitor { protected BoundTreeWalker() { } public void VisitList<T>(ImmutableArray<T> list) where T : BoundNode { if (!list.IsDefault) { for (int i = 0; i < list.Length; i++) { this.Visit(list[i]); } } } protected void VisitUnoptimizedForm(BoundQueryClause queryClause) { BoundExpression? unoptimizedForm = queryClause.UnoptimizedForm; // The unoptimized form of a query has an additional argument in the call, // which is typically the "trivial" expression x where x is the query // variable. So that we can make sense of x in this // context, we store the unoptimized form and visit this extra argument. var qc = unoptimizedForm as BoundQueryClause; if (qc != null) unoptimizedForm = qc.Value; var call = unoptimizedForm as BoundCall; if (call != null && (object)call.Method != null) { var arguments = call.Arguments; if (call.Method.Name == "Select") { this.Visit(arguments[arguments.Length - 1]); } else if (call.Method.Name == "GroupBy") { this.Visit(arguments[arguments.Length - 2]); } } } } /// <summary> /// Note: do not use a static/singleton instance of this type, as it holds state. /// </summary> internal abstract class B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uard : BoundTreeWalker { private int _recursionDepth; protected B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uard() { } protected B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uard(int recursionDepth) { _recursionDepth = recursionDepth; } protected int RecursionDepth => _recursionDepth; public override BoundNode? Visit(BoundNode? node) { if (node is BoundExpression or BoundPattern) { return VisitExpressionOrPatternWithStackGuard(ref _recursionDepth, node); } return base.Visit(node); } protected BoundNode VisitExpressionOrPatternWithStackGuard(BoundNode node) { return VisitExpressionOrPatternWithStackGuard(ref _recursionDepth, node); } protected sealed override BoundNode VisitExpressionOrPatternWithoutStackGuard(BoundNode node) { Debug.Assert(node is BoundExpression or BoundPattern); return base.Visit(node); } } /// <summary> /// Note: do not use a static/singleton instance of this type, as it holds state. /// </summary> internal abstract class B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uardWithoutRecursionOnTheLeftOfBinaryOperator : B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uard { protected B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uardWithoutRecursionOnTheLeftOfBinaryOperator() { } protected BoundTreeWalkerWithStackGuardWithoutRecursionOnTheLeftOfBinaryOperator(int recursionDepth) : base(recursionDepth) { } public sealed override BoundNode? VisitBinaryOperator(BoundBinaryOperator node) { if (node.Left is not BoundBinaryOperator binary) { return base.VisitBinaryOperator(node); } var rightOperands = ArrayBuilder<BoundExpression>.GetInstance(); rightOperands.Push(node.Right); B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undBinaryOperatorChildren(binary); rightOperands.Push(binary.Right); BoundExpression? current = binary.Left; while (current.Kind == BoundKind.BinaryOperator) { binary = (BoundBinaryOperator)current; B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undBinaryOperatorChildren(binary); rightOperands.Push(binary.Right); current = binary.Left; } this.Visit(current); current = rightOperands.Pop(); do { this.Visit(current); } while (rightOperands.TryPop(out current)); rightOperands.Free(); return null; } protected virtual void B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undBinaryOperatorChildren(BoundBinaryOperator node) { } public sealed override BoundNode? VisitBinaryPattern(BoundBinaryPattern node) { if (node.Left is not BoundBinaryPattern binary) { return base.VisitBinaryPattern(node); } var rightOperands = ArrayBuilder<BoundPattern>.GetInstance(); rightOperands.Push(node.Right); rightOperands.Push(binary.Right); BoundPattern? current = binary.Left; while (current.Kind == BoundKind.BinaryPattern) { binary = (BoundBinaryPattern)current; rightOperands.Push(binary.Right); current = binary.Left; } Visit(current); current = rightOperands.Pop(); do { Visit(current); } while (rightOperands.TryPop(out current)); rightOperands.Free(); return null; } public override BoundNode? VisitCall(BoundCall node) { if (node.ReceiverOpt is BoundCall receiver1) { var calls = ArrayBuilder<BoundCall>.GetInstance(); calls.Push(node); node = receiver1; while (node.ReceiverOpt is BoundCall receiver2) { B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undCallChildren(node); calls.Push(node); node = receiver2; } B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undCallChildren(node); VisitReceiver(node); do { VisitArguments(node); } while (calls.TryPop(out node!)); calls.Free(); } else { VisitReceiver(node); VisitArguments(node); } return null; } protected virtual void BeforeVisitingSkippedBoundCallChildren(BoundCall node) { } /// <summary> /// Called only for the first (in evaluation order) <see cref="BoundCall"/> in the chain. /// </summary> protected virtual void VisitReceiver(BoundCall node) { this.Visit(node.ReceiverOpt); } protected virtual void VisitArguments(BoundCall node) { this.VisitList(node.Arguments); } public sealed override BoundNode? VisitIfStatement(BoundIfStatement node) { while (true) { Visit(node.Condition); Visit(node.Consequence); var alternative = node.AlternativeOpt; if (alternative is null) { break; } if (alternative is BoundIfStatement elseIfStatement) { node = elseIfStatement; } else { Visit(alternative); break; } } return null; } } }
